South West > Employment > Employment: Bristol

Bevan Brittan LLP excels in catering to clients in government, higher education, and housing, though the firm also counts a number of household names from the private sector amongst its client portfolio. Led by Jodie Sinclair from London, the team handles matters relating to day-to-day HR advice, equal pay, senior level departures, and collective bargaining. Julian Hoskins regularly advises clients in the health sector on employment issues, while Sarah Lamont‘s expertise spans discrimination cases, restructurings, and mergers. James Gutteridge was promoted to partner in 2023 and primarily deals with contentious work, often for NHS clients.

West Midlands > Employment > Employment

Under the joint leadership of London-based Jodie Sinclair and Birmingham-based Ashley Norman, the team at Bevan Brittan LLP has considerable expertise in the healthcare, housing and local government sectors. More recently, its work has also expanded into the private, education and international arenas. Norman works on a range of contentious and advisory employment matters. Newly promoted partner James Gutteridge is the primary employment lead for a number of key NHS clients.

The ‘practical and solution-focused’ team at Bevan Brittan LLP is ably led by Jodie Sinclair. The group has considerable niche expertise in the NHS and independent health and care sectors. It supports these employers on a wide range of issues, such as workforce redesign projects through to employment litigation and whistleblowing cases. It is also skilled at handling many other issues, including consultant engagement models, and developing organisational approaches to complex gender identities. Alastair Currie is highly regarded for his knowledge of healthcare contractual and regulatory frameworks.
